Manchester United captain Bruno Fernandes has become the subject of intense transfer speculation, with reports suggesting the Portuguese midfielder could be on the move this summer.

The 29-year-old playmaker, who has been United's standout performer since joining from Sporting Lisbon in 2020, is reportedly attracting interest from Saudi Pro League clubs as well as European heavyweights Bayern Munich and Barcelona.

Contract Situation Fuels Speculation

Fernandes' current deal runs until 2026, but United's failure to qualify for the Champions League has raised questions about his future at Old Trafford. The club's new co-owner Sir Jim Ratcliffe is believed to be considering a major squad overhaul, with no player guaranteed to be safe from potential sales.

Saudi Interest Growing

Sources suggest Saudi clubs are preparing a lucrative offer that could tempt both the player and United. The Middle Eastern league has already secured several high-profile Premier League stars, and Fernandes could be their next big target.

European Giants Circle

Bayern Munich see Fernandes as a potential replacement for Joshua Kimmich, while Barcelona's new manager Hansi Flick is reportedly a long-time admirer of the Portuguese international. Both clubs could offer Champions League football - something United can't provide next season.

What This Means for United

Losing their captain would be a massive blow for Erik ten Hag's side as they look to rebuild. Fernandes has been United's creative heartbeat, contributing 79 goals and 66 assists in 232 appearances across all competitions.

However, with Financial Fair Play constraints, a big-money sale could provide funds for Ten Hag to reshape his squad. The coming weeks will be crucial in determining whether Fernandes remains a key part of United's future or becomes their latest high-profile departure.
